E–Beltre 2 (7). DP–Seattle 1. Beltre-Lopez-Branyan, Minnesota 2. Harris-Tolbert-Morneau, Buscher-Tolbert-Morneau. 2B–Seattle Lopez (5,off Liriano); Beltre (9,off Liriano), Minnesota Span (4,off Hernandez); Mauer (3,off Hernandez). HR–Seattle Sweeney (2,4th inning off Liriano 1 on 1 out); Beltre (1,8th inning off Guerrier 0 on 0 out), Minnesota Mauer (3,3rd inning off Hernandez 0 on 2 out); Morneau (8,3rd inning off Hernandez 0 on 2 out); Cuddyer (3,5th inning off White 2 on 1 out). HBP–Suzuki (1,by Liriano). Team LOB–5. SF–Span (2,off Hernandez). Team–6. SB–Beltre (5,2nd base off Liriano/Mauer). CS–Beltre (2,3rd base by Liriano/Mauer); Span (1,2nd base by Hernandez/Johjima). U-HP–Eric Cooper, 1B–Tim McClelland, 2B–Laz Diaz, 3B–Chuck Meriwether. T–2:56. A–29,552. |
